The document provides information about AAA's Diamond Rating System for hotels and restaurants. It explains that AAA uses Approval Requirements, which are mandatory standards, and Diamond Rating Guidelines, which are more flexible, to evaluate properties. The Approval Requirements section lists 33 standards that must be met for a property to receive AAA Approval, covering cleanliness, management practices, exterior/public areas, guestrooms, and bathrooms. Meeting these standards is the first step before a property can be considered for a Diamond Rating.
